Chuyển đổi XML sang PDF

Giới thiệu

Trong thời đại kỹ thuật số ngày nay, khả năng chuyển đổi liền mạch các tệp từ định dạng này sang định dạng khác là điều tối quan trọng. Cho dù bạn là nhà phát triển, chuyên gia kinh doanh hay đơn giản là một cá nhân có nhu cầu định dạng tệp đa dạng, việc có quyền truy cập vào các công cụ chuyển đổi đáng tin cậy có thể hợp lý hóa quy trình làm việc của bạn và nâng cao năng suất. GroupDocs.Conversion for .NET là một thư viện mạnh mẽ cung cấp cho các nhà phát triển khả năng chuyển đổi nhiều định dạng tài liệu theo chương trình. Từ chuyển đổi XML sang PDF đến chuyển đổi tài liệu Microsoft Word thành HTML, công cụ đa năng này cung cấp một loạt chức năng để đáp ứng các yêu cầu chuyển đổi đa dạng. Trong hướng dẫn này, chúng tôi sẽ tập trung vào việc chuyển đổi tệp XML sang PDF bằng GroupDocs.Conversion cho .NET. Bằng cách làm theo hướng dẫn từng bước được nêu bên dưới, bạn sẽ tìm hiểu cách khai thác tiềm năng của thư viện này để chuyển đổi liền mạch các tài liệu XML sang định dạng PDF.

Điều kiện tiên quyết

Trước khi chúng ta đi sâu vào quá trình chuyển đổi, hãy đảm bảo rằng bạn có sẵn các điều kiện tiên quyết sau:

  1. GroupDocs.Conversion for .NET Library: Tải xuống và cài đặt thư viện GroupDocs.Conversion for .NET từ thư viện được cung cấpLiên kết tải xuống. Làm theo hướng dẫn cài đặt để tích hợp thư viện vào dự án .NET của bạn thành công.
  2. Môi trường phát triển: Thiết lập môi trường phát triển với Visual Studio hoặc bất kỳ IDE ưa thích nào để phát triển .NET.
  3. Tài liệu XML: Chuẩn bị tài liệu XML mà bạn định chuyển đổi sang PDF. Đảm bảo rằng tệp XML có cấu trúc chính xác và chứa dữ liệu cần thiết.

Nhập không gian tên

Để bắt đầu quá trình chuyển đổi, hãy nhập các vùng tên cần thiết vào dự án .NET của bạn. Các không gian tên này cung cấp quyền truy cập vào các lớp và phương thức cần thiết để thực hiện chuyển đổi một cách liền mạch.

using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;

Bây giờ bạn đã có sẵn các điều kiện tiên quyết và các không gian tên cần thiết đã được nhập, hãy tiếp tục chuyển đổi tài liệu XML sang định dạng PDF bằng cách sử dụng GroupDocs.Conversion cho .NET.

Bước 1: Xác định thư mục đầu ra và đường dẫn tệp

string outputFolder = "Your Document Directory";
string outputFile = Path.Combine(outputFolder, "xml-converted-to.pdf");

Bước 2: Tải tệp XML nguồn

using (var converter = new GroupDocs.Conversion.Converter(Constants.SAMPLE_XML))
{
	// Logic chuyển đổi sẽ xuất hiện ở đây
}

Bước 3: Định cấu hình tùy chọn chuyển đổi

	var options = new PdfConvertOptions();

Bước 4: Thực hiện chuyển đổi

	// Lưu tệp PDF đã chuyển đổi
	converter.Convert(outputFile, options);

Bước 5: Hiển thị thông báo hoàn thành chuyển đổi

	Console.WriteLine("\nConversion to pdf completed successfully. \nCheck output in {0}", outputFolder);

Phần kết luận

Tóm lại, GroupDocs.Conversion for .NET cung cấp một giải pháp liền mạch để chuyển đổi tệp XML sang định dạng PDF. Bằng cách làm theo các bước đơn giản được nêu trong hướng dẫn này, bạn có thể chuyển đổi tài liệu XML của mình thành PDF một cách hiệu quả, tạo điều kiện thuận lợi cho việc quản lý tài liệu và khả năng truy cập tốt hơn. Với các tính năng mạnh mẽ và khả năng tích hợp dễ dàng, GroupDocs.Conversion trao quyền cho các nhà phát triển giải quyết các tác vụ chuyển đổi tài liệu một cách dễ dàng, nâng cao năng suất và hiệu quả quy trình làm việc.

Câu hỏi thường gặp

GroupDocs.Conversion cho .NET có tương thích với tất cả các phiên bản .NET không?

Có, GroupDocs.Conversion for .NET tương thích với nhiều phiên bản của .NET framework, đảm bảo khả năng tương thích rộng rãi trên các môi trường phát triển khác nhau.

Tôi có thể tùy chỉnh các tùy chọn chuyển đổi theo yêu cầu cụ thể của mình không?

Hoàn toàn có thể, GroupDocs.Conversion for .NET cung cấp các tùy chọn tùy chỉnh mở rộng, cho phép các nhà phát triển điều chỉnh quy trình chuyển đổi cho phù hợp với nhu cầu riêng của họ.

GroupDocs.Conversion có hỗ trợ chuyển đổi hàng loạt tệp không?

Có, GroupDocs.Conversion hỗ trợ chuyển đổi hàng loạt, cho phép người dùng chuyển đổi nhiều tệp cùng lúc, nhờ đó tiết kiệm thời gian và công sức.

Có hỗ trợ kỹ thuật cho người dùng GroupDocs.Conversion không?

Có, GroupDocs cung cấp hỗ trợ kỹ thuật chuyên dụng để hỗ trợ người dùng về bất kỳ thắc mắc hoặc vấn đề nào họ có thể gặp phải trong quá trình triển khai hoặc sử dụng thư viện.

Tôi có thể dùng thử GroupDocs.Conversion trước khi mua hàng không?

Chắc chắn, những người dùng quan tâm có thể tận dụng bản dùng thử miễn phí của GroupDocs.ConversionLiên kết tải xuống để khám phá các tính năng và khả năng của nó trước khi đưa ra quyết định mua hàng.